how do you decide which rational number operations to use to solve the problems?

Respuesta :

lelandsawyer72
lelandsawyer72 lelandsawyer72
  • 19-10-2021

Answer:

The process of "choosing the operation" involves deciding which mathematical operation (addition, subtraction, multiplication, or division) or combination of operations will be useful in solving a word problem.
